Individualism and Liberty by James W. Harris _________________________________ Self-Government Our political system is based, they say, on self-government. So we vote every two years on who will govern us in virtually every aspect of our lives. But if we try instead to govern ourselves, We will be jailed or shot. It is self-government, so long as you Do not actually Attempt to. _________________________________ Bad Child We had such high Expectations For the Child But he Let us Down. So we Punished him. Bad child! Bad child! We had such Great plans For you But you Ruined it all By becoming Yourself. _________________________________ Louder Faster Blinding Make everything Louder faster brighter Screaming Blinding Ever more disjointed Ever-changing Virtually Meaningless And I won't ever Have to think Or reflect Or even be Able To. _________________________________ The Great Racket They crack down on the gamblers While draining suckers with their lotteries. They crack down on drugs While running liquor stores and subsiding tobacco. They go after burglars While taxing us at 70%. They say they protect our liberty By conscripting us as slaves. They prattle about the glories of free speech Unless such speech threatens them, In which case they Savagely suppress it. Any smart school child can see through this And would laugh at them, But there aren't so many Smart school children, Because they control the schools, Too. _________________________________ Prisons for Children Schools are Prisons For Children. The children's crime Is to be Full of Passion Wild energy A thirst for knowledge To question And challenge Everything In other words, To be fully Alive and human. The schools Cure this. Then the children, Transformed, Are released, On permanent parole, Into Adulthood. _________________________________ Berlin Wall Around His Brain The government schools built a Berlin Wall around his brain. No ideas of his own Can leave, No new ideas can enter without a passport stamped by government officials at the border. Armed border guards stand ready to shoot and kill unauthorized trespassers from either direction. _________________________________ They will Kill You They will kill you if you give them Half a chance. They will kill you for being Too smart, because they are not, Too rich, because they envy success. Too poor, because they hate themselves, Too ugly, because they can't see the beauty in you or themselves, Too beautiful, so beautiful they can't kill it or sell it or steal it, Too talented, because they can't go to that same place They will kill you for being different Unless they can use that difference. And they will also kill you if you aren't so different, If you hang around with them And become them, And that death will be the slowest and worst of all. _________________________________ The Right What gives you The right To live So freely, Not worrying Even a little bit About What others Think of you? And how long Do you think You can get away With it? _________________________________ The Right to Remain Silent You have the right To remain silent But the moral Obligation To scream In outrage _________________________________ Discovery He suddenly discovered he could fly! And he laughed and raised his arms and prepared to soar but we caught him and killed him and pissed on his corpse because we could not. _________________________________ We Are Free The State takes half our income in taxes, But we are free. The State raises and educates our children, But we are free. The State tells us what we can and cannot ingest, But we are free. The State commands us to fight and die in its wars, But we are free. The State controls every single aspect Of our personal and economic lives, But we are free We are free We are oh so gloriously Free And we know it Because The State tells us so, Constantly. _________________________________ No Ropes No Chains There are no ropes Or chains Around me. I can do almost anything Say almost anything I want. But I cant think Of anything to do Or say Except the same things Everyone else Is doing And saying. Sometimes ropes and chains Are not needed. Most of the time, Actually. _________________________________ The Revolution Will Be Trademarked and Sold Rebellion is packaged And sold Like every other commodity You can buy your Circle A (tm) T-shirt At the mall, The cars say you can drive to freedom If you mortgage yourself to purchase them, The restaurants say says You can have it your way And there are No rules. You can probably buy stock In rebellion, Theres probably a rebellion Mutual fund. It is all of course A big load of shit As you perhaps Will discover Soon enough. _________________________________ Lawd Have Mercy They can say "People of color." But if I say "Colored people," Well, Holy Mackeral deah, Boss, Here come de Lynch mob. _________________________________ The Human Race He told the truth And they beat him But he would not Shut up So They killed him. Their grandchildren Accepted his heresy As obvious, even banal, And wondered how Their elders could ever Have been so foolish, Even as they themselves Tortured some poor fool To death For speaking some New Truth. _________________________________ One Day You Will Thank Us One day you will thank us, they said as they dragged the young man into the operating room and despite his struggles pinned him to the table clamped him down and set to work. It was painful, shattering, and he fought back, jerking against his restraints, clawing, scratching, screaming grasping at air. But resistance was futile. Eventually, they finished And stepped back to Inspect their work. Success! He was Just like them, Just like everyone else. And they were right, One day he did indeed Thank them. But he was not The same Young man. _________________________________ Everybody Look Alike Everybody looks alike Everybody dresses alike Everybody wears ads On their feet and chests Everybody's got the same kind of Holes drilled in their ears and noses. Everybody worships death Death is the newest fashion trend Skulls and black gowns Death, death, death. Death for sale At the mall, At Wal-Mart. Death songs on the Top 40. Serial killers The new movie stars. To love life is the Ultimate anti-fashion Statement. _________________________________ The Human Billboards Hey man How much is that corporation Paying you To wear their fucking AD On your shirt? _________________________________ More Immoral Than Me There are people Far more immoral than me, But they dont know it So that makes me Far worse. _________________________________ The March of the Stupid People Look, It is the March of the Stupid People. Tromp, tromp, Here they come! Tromp, tromp, So many of them, All ages, races, Tromp, tromp. They march a bit Raggedly, yes, But with such Enthusiasm It more than Compensates. Tromp, tromp, They are on some new Great crusade -- Some Great Cause Has momentarily seized their Ever-volatile Attention, Tromp, tromp, And off they go. Tromp, tromp, I expect many will die And they in turn Will kill Many similar ones Before it is all over. Tromp, tromp. Whatever it is It is no doubt Meaningless And will accomplish Nothing of value And will shortly be Utterly forgotten, But it will keep them occupied Until the next Great Cause Comes along. Tromp, tromp, Tromp, tromp, Yes, their band plays Beautiful martial music And the old sentimental favorites And hymns And of course The National Anthem. And yes, I applaud And cheer And wave As they pass And I strongly suggest You do, too. Then, when they have gone, I will lay low and be quiet For a while. For though I despise them I also greatly fear them And There are So many Of them, As you can See. |
